Flowering Shrubs For Landscaping Makes Sense



It is common to hear about people redecorating their home. What you don't hear about as much is people caring the same way for their gardens. Taking the same time on your yard can be just as profitable as the interior of your home. You can get the most out of your water, money, and area by using flowering shrubs for landscaping in addition to traditional flowering plants.

It is easy to get the most out of your space by using shrubbery. Many gardens lack depth because all the plants are the same height. Shrubbery can add height in strategic places. This adds interest to your garden and can help to section or divide parts of your garden like a living divider.

You can find it in varying heights and widths. It is possible to find shrubbery that flowers in any season as well as evergreens. The versatility of this plant is a gardeners dream. Bushes can be used in all sorts of way.

It has been established that they will work as a way to separate one large space into several more intimate spaces. It also should be mentioned how well they work as borders to paths and drives. They can just as easily serve as fencing. By selecting a variety that blooms, you can add large amount of color to your yard in one planting. Mass plantings are beautiful but it can be tedious to do and then to maintain and weed. When you mass plant bushes that bloom you can get the color that you want with the ease of having to only plant and maintain a few plants versus dozens.

At first glance it can seem that it costs more to invest in shrubbery over plants. But after closer inspection you can see that it takes many more plants than bushes to get the same amount of coverage. If you do the math it could end up that for the area covered individual plants end up costing more.

Bushes save just as much water as they do time. Bushes can be found in all climates. Because of this you can find plants that are very drought tolerant and do not require much watering. The amount of water used for individual plants or for your lawn can be double what you use for certain types of shrubbery.

Using flowering shrubs for landscaping make a big difference for a little money and effort in your garden. They are easy to plant and easy to care for. They have blooms and vegetation in all different colors. They are a beautiful and versatile choice for any garden.
